The Science of Cannabis

更新於 發佈於 閱讀時間約 10 分鐘

Cannabis has long been a subject of intrigue and research, primarily due to its complex chemical composition and the profound effects it has on the human body. Understanding the science behind cannabis involves delving into its chemical compounds, their interactions with our physiology, and the potential benefits and risks associated with its use.


Chemical Compounds

Overview of THC, CBD, and Other Cannabinoids


Cannabis contains a myriad of chemical compounds, with cannabinoids being the most prominent. The two most well-known cannabinoids are tetrahydrocannabinol (THC) and cannabidiol (CBD). 

  • THC is the primary psychoactive compound in cannabis, responsible for the "high" commonly associated with marijuana use. It interacts with the brain’s receptors, influencing mood, perception, and cognition.
  • CBD on the other hand, is non-psychoactive and has gained attention for its potential therapeutic benefits. It does not produce a high but may help with anxiety, inflammation, and various medical conditions.

Beyond THC and CBD, cannabis contains over a hundred other cannabinoids, such as cannabigerol (CBG) and cannabinol (CBN), each with unique properties and potential benefits.


The Entourage Effect

The concept of the "entourage effect" refers to the synergistic interaction between cannabinoids, terpenes, and other compounds found in cannabis. This theory posits that the various components of the plant work together to enhance its overall effects, potentially leading to greater therapeutic outcomes than any single compound alone. For instance, certain terpenes, which contribute to cannabis’s aroma and flavor, may enhance the efficacy of cannabinoids, making the understanding of cannabis's full potential more complex and intriguing.


Effects on the Body

How Cannabinoids Interact with the Endocannabinoid System

The endocannabinoid system (ECS) is a critical regulatory system in the human body that helps maintain homeostasis. It comprises cannabinoid receptors (CB1 and CB2), endocannabinoids (natural cannabinoids produced by the body), and enzymes that break down these compounds. 


When cannabinoids from cannabis are introduced into the body, they bind to these receptors, influencing various physiological processes such as pain perception, mood regulation, immune response, and appetite. For example, THC primarily binds to CB1 receptors in the brain, which can affect cognitive function and perception. In contrast, CBD interacts more indirectly, modulating the ECS and enhancing the overall balance within the system.


Potential Therapeutic Benefits and Risks

Research into the therapeutic benefits of cannabis has revealed promising results. Patients report relief from chronic pain, reduced anxiety, improved sleep quality, and management of conditions like epilepsy and multiple sclerosis. The potential for cannabis to alleviate symptoms of various ailments has led to its increased acceptance in the medical community.


However, the use of cannabis is not without risks. High doses of THC can lead to adverse effects, such as anxiety, paranoia, and impaired cognitive function. Long-term use, especially in adolescents, may affect brain development and increase the risk of mental health disorders. Furthermore, the lack of regulation in some areas can lead to inconsistencies in product quality and cannabinoid concentrations, complicating safe use.
